Globalization is an economic and cultural phenomenon that has transformed labor relations, production and marketing of goods and services around the world. The sustainability of globalization has been through the development of information and communication technologies that have connected the markets, reducing operational costs and the importance of regional barriers. This phenomenon has opened space for the emergence of new consumer markets, products and new forms of business.
